Output 7129e07a7068ac42ba5bb2e4b96e063f5a6c4e5bd8ce2f6c8a3b02add8568f31:1

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c042db08e7c4e96028af12eb4ea04e6efb91e510 OP_EQUAL
address
3KDbkapxwpY5RtSkZY69ViAMR2Ar7fCWKR
transaction
7129e07a7068ac42ba5bb2e4b96e063f5a6c4e5bd8ce2f6c8a3b02add8568f31
spent
true